From 02e535b5a17808c1b604c60d0a25b08c26c9d107 Mon Sep 17 00:00:00 2001 From: = Date: Thu, 31 Dec 2020 09:18:29 +1100 Subject: [PATCH] Fix for recurring invoice null next_send_date --- app/Models/RecurringInvoice.php |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/app/Models/RecurringInvoice.php b/app/Models/RecurringInvoice.php index 94358ec74b90..7d28949e2f2a 100644 --- a/app/Models/RecurringInvoice.php +++ b/app/Models/RecurringInvoice.php @@ -366,10 +366,14 @@ class RecurringInvoice extends BaseModel if ($this->remaining_cycles == -1) { $iterations = 10; } + + $data = []; + if(!$this->next_send_date) + return $data; + $next_send_date = Carbon::parse($this->next_send_date)->copy(); - $data = []; for ($x=0; $x<$iterations; $x++) { // we don't add the days... we calc the day of the month!!